If you think that you can use the meal plans that you have found on the internet, think again. There are various factors that influence your dietary strategies and nutritional requirements for your training or competition day. Here are some factors that can cause changes to your nutrition plans.
The Individual's Factors
Genetics
Gender (biological)
Age
Body Weight
Fitness level or Years of experience in the sport
Sweat rate during the various types of training sessions or competition
The current metabolism
Current Health status e.g. deficient in a certain nutrient, have a medical condition, etc.
Your food preferences
Your food tolerances
The menstrual phase you are in (for biological females)
Your Nutritional Goals
Meeting your fuel demands of the type and duration of the training session
Reducing or delaying factors that would cause fatigue specific to the training session or competition event.
Adapting to the training sessions
Performing well at your competition/ Break your Personal Best
Recover from exercises/ training session(s)/ competition
Weight loss
Weight gain
Rehabilitation from injury or illness
The Environment that you are Training or Competing
The weather such as exercising in the heat and humid climate versus exercising in the cold and dry climate
The time of the year when in temperate countries
Altitude level e.g. sea level versus on the mountain
